I'm using xsltproc to transform XML document and trying to figure out what exactly the --novalid option influences. As it seems to me, even if this option is not specified, the DTD is not used for validating the input document.
If I specify "--novalid" on the command line, the DTDs referenced in the input document are completely ignored, they even may be missing - what makes sense. On the other hand, if I do NOT specify "--novalid", I get an error message saying "failed to load external entity" if the DTD is missing or a "unable to parse" message, if the DTD is corrupt; if the DTD is well-formed however, but the input document does not complies to the constraints in the DTD (i.e. it is not a valid XML document), nothing happens. What am I missing?
